Solving for Durability: Steel Construction Matters

Steel gauge determines cabinet strength. Lower gauge numbers indicate thicker, stronger steel.

Premium cabinets use 22-24 gauge steel. Budget options often use 26-28 gauge. The difference becomes apparent when loading heavy tools.

Steel GaugeThicknessBest For
22-24 gaugeThickest (0.025-0.020 inch)Professional use, heavy tools
25-26 gaugeMedium (0.020-0.018 inch)Serious DIYers, home mechanics
27-28 gaugeThinnest (0.016-0.014 inch)Light storage, budget options

Solving for Weight Capacity: Know the Real Limits

Manufacturer weight capacity ratings often assume distributed weight. Real-world tool storage concentrates weight in specific areas.

I recommend assuming 60-70% of rated capacity for realistic expectations. A shelf rated for 200 pounds should be loaded to about 120-140 pounds for safety.

Shelf Capacity: The maximum weight a single shelf can support evenly distributed. Always consider point load weight where heavy items concentrate pressure in one spot.

Solving for Space: Measure Before Buying

Garage space varies widely. Measure your available space before shopping, accounting for:

  • Ceiling height: Standard garages have 8-foot ceilings. Tall cabinets (72+ inches) require careful measurement.
  • Garage door tracks: Don’t block door operation with cabinet placement.
  • Walking paths: Maintain 3-foot minimum walkways for safe movement.
  • Vehicle clearance: Ensure cabinets don’t interfere with parking.

Solving for Security: Lock Options Explained

Locking cabinets provide varying levels of security:

Lock TypeSecurity LevelBest For
Basic cam lockLow – deters casual accessKeeping kids out, light deterrence
Keyed cylinder lockMedium – resists pryingHome security, tool protection
Multi-point lockingHigh – professional securityValuable tools, commercial use

Solving for Mobility: Wheels vs. Stationary

Rolling cabinets offer flexibility but trade stability for mobility. Consider your garage usage pattern:

  • Mobile benefits: Reposition for projects, clean behind easily, create temporary workspaces.
  • Stationary benefits: Greater stability, often higher weight capacity, simpler construction.

Pro Tip: If choosing rolling cabinets, look for models with wheel locks. They provide mobility when needed and stability when parked.

Solving for Climate: Garage Environmental Factors

Garages experience extreme temperature and humidity fluctuations. Your cabinets need to handle these conditions:

  • Powder-coated steel: Best rust resistance for metal cabinets.
  • Sealed cabinets: Protect tools from dust and moisture better than open shelving.
  • Climate consideration: In humid areas, add desiccants inside sealed cabinets to prevent tool rust.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best material for garage cabinets?

Steel is the best material for garage cabinets due to its durability, weight capacity, and resistance to pests and moisture. Powder-coated steel offers excellent rust resistance. Wood cabinets can work in climate-controlled garages but may warp in humid conditions. Plastic/resin cabinets are affordable but lack the weight capacity for heavy tools and can become brittle in cold temperatures.

How much should I spend on garage cabinets?

Budget $150-400 for basic cabinets suitable for light tool storage. Mid-range options ($400-800) offer better construction and security for serious DIYers. Premium systems ($800-2000+) provide professional-grade durability for heavy use. Avoid cabinets under $150 for tool storage. They typically use thin materials that bend under weight and hardware that fails quickly. Invest in quality now rather than replacing cheap cabinets later.

Are metal or wood garage cabinets better?

Metal cabinets are better for most garage environments. They handle moisture and temperature fluctuations without warping, support heavier weights, and resist pests. Wood cabinets can work in climate-controlled garages and offer aesthetic appeal, but they’re susceptible to humidity damage and generally have lower weight capacity. Metal cabinets with powder coating provide the best combination of durability and rust resistance for typical garage conditions.

How do I organize my garage with cabinets?

Start by categorizing tools into groups: frequently used, occasionally used, and seasonal. Place frequently used tools at eye level in easily accessible cabinets. Store heavy items on lower shelves for stability and safety. Use upper shelves for seasonal and lightweight items. Consider wall-mounted cabinets above workbenches to maximize floor space. Label cabinet contents and group related tools together. Create dedicated zones for different activities: automotive, woodworking, general repairs.

What size garage cabinets should I buy?

For small tool collections, start with one 36-inch wide cabinet. Medium collections benefit from 48-72 inch wide cabinets or multiple smaller units. Large collections or workshops need comprehensive systems with 100+ inches of total cabinet width. Standard cabinet depth is 18-24 inches. Height options range from 36-72 inches, with 72 inches utilizing standard garage ceiling height most effectively. Measure your space and vehicle clearances before purchasing.

Can I put kitchen cabinets in a garage?

Kitchen cabinets can work in garages but require modifications. They’re not designed for temperature fluctuations or humidity, which can cause warping and finish issues. Use only solid wood cabinets, not particleboard or MDF which swell with moisture. Seal all surfaces with polyurethane for moisture protection. Install only in climate-controlled garages. While cheaper initially, kitchen cabinets typically fail faster than purpose-built garage cabinets and may cost more in the long run when replacement is factored in.
